Portrait of Duchess Sforza Cesarini
Artist: Pompeo Batoni (Italian, 1708–1787)
Date: 1768
Medium: Oil on canvas
Collection: Birmingham Museums Trust, Birmingham, England
Duchess Sforza Cesarini
Caroline Shirley, Duchess Sforza Cesarini (December 1818 – 17 November 1897) was an Englishwoman who married into the Italian aristocracy at the age of eighteen. She is noteworthy for having become, half a century later, the patroness of the writer Frederick Rolfe.
